So, for a long, long time I've heard, and believed, that getting from holy to nuetral is way easier (don't get me wrong, it's pretty easy), while getting from damned to nuetral would take a long time of arduous, hard work. Today, I found that to be... odd, when I, mostly by accident, hit nuetral from damned, after hunting a good bit in CA, a pretty well known goodie area. I hunted krougs a lot, both sides of Palanthas (which I believe is a net 0 effect?)
So... yea...
And, a while ago, when I went merc/oots from templar/AA, I ground from damned to holy in another often overlooked area... Flotsam/Port Balifor, including CoC. Both of these are smaller, mostly everyday areas (gotta be rising hero+ to safely handle the three roaming BDA soldiers in Flotsam)
I really don't think wights are the best spot for align grinding, even if they're fairly evil, coz a. there are stories of needing to kill thousands to get good, which takes some time, and b. if it doesn't take much time... just do khiraa, those are a rapid pace align raiser, or... the two above areas.
This note is meant to communicate two things, primarily to medium sized goodies lookin' to quickly hit that much wanted holy align, be it for oots, or heralds, or any number of reasons, and secondly... to help remove some of this idea that align grinding to good is *sooo* hard
yea, it's easier to be evil, and that goes for IRL too, but honestly, just like IRL, it just takes small things to change for the better

If y'all are interested in directions for a path of krougs, I gotchu, you wanna start at the nw-ernmost room, with teeny tiny krougs, and you're path should include a speed walk unless you want to fight the darkness kroug, who will break your weapons and end your life (=

7e, se, 8w, 9e, se, 4w, se, 3e, s, 2w, s, 2e, s, 2w, s, 2e, s, 3w, sw, 4e, [sw 7w nw], 4w, n, 3e, nw, 2w, n, 2e, n, 2w, n, 2e, n, 2w, n, 3e, [4n]

Things in square brackets ( '[' and ']' ) should be fastwalked for ease and safety

I never pathed Flotsam/Balifor coz that's a contestable area, bein' blue DA territory, and Krynn itself can be a dangerous PvP area, best to stay 110% attentive, and not need even an extra 5-10s of path disabling to stop movin' around while bein' brutally murded :lol:

EDIT for avengers info:

Name: avengers
Type: regexp
Pattern: avenger storms in with a (.*) scream of hatred!

Execute the following commands:
!kill avenger

This will solve all your avenger problems, I tried it without it, and no joke, I had *15* avengers following me around and draining my mana with their pesky lightning bolts at the end of the path, so... don't do that :lol:
